Handover note — Crumbwheel order cutoffs.

Welcome aboard. The bakery cutoff rule in Crumbwheel closes same-day orders at 14:00 local to each storefront, not UTC — this has bitten us twice. Holiday overrides live in the calendar service and take precedence silently, so always check there first when a cutoff looks wrong. To unlock the calendar service's admin console after a restart, enter the recovery passphrase below.

vault phrase of bagap-bahaf = silion-pelox-sorox-casdor-quenwyn-fraax-eliox-praael-kelion-quenvan-kasox-rusael-norius-belvan

Internal Memo — Supplier Contract Renewal

For the incoming director: the Ashgrove Components agreement expires at quarter-end. Current terms include volume rebates and a fixed logistics surcharge; both warrant renegotiation given our shift to the Larkfield line. Procurement recommends a two-year renewal with quarterly price reviews. Please review the draft terms before the Ashgrove meeting. The negotiating position we intend to hold is set out in the confidential note below.

management briefing: Project Ulavan slips by two quarters because of the staffing delay.

Welcome to the Liftwise team at Carrowgate Systems. Your first task area is the elevator-dispatch simulator, which models car assignment across our virtual 40-floor test tower. The simulator replays recorded call patterns and scores dispatch strategies on average wait time and energy use. You'll run it locally, but results upload to the Hoistmetric aggregation service so the whole team can compare runs. Uploads authenticate with the shared contractor key for that service, included just below.

gateway credential: kto3_qfe